From Big 4 Tax to MSF to Investment Banking Analyst
Hi All,
So I am looking to switch careers to Investment banking and get a job preferably in the NYC area. I am currently in the hedge fund and private equity tax group at a Big 4 in NYC. 2nd year Associate to be exact.
I just got admitted to do an MSF program at Baruch College. I decided to attend Baruch specifically because of the course schedule, low tuition and the ability to still be working full time with my current firm while taking classes full time (Trust me, this is sorted out already and there is no conflict here).
Undergraduate wise, I got a Bsc in Finance from a liberal arts college in the middle of nowhere, but hey I still got a job at a Big 4 and passed the CPA and CFA Level I exams already!. Have prior trading experience and couple of internships in equity + fixed income research at a small investment firm in NYC. I applied but didn't get a job offer in IB when I graduated.
I would like to get advice on what to do now to land an investment banking position after I graduate from my MSF. Insights on even my chances of getting a job in IB would be great.
I am fine joining either a new analyst or associate position from any of the banks, BB or mid size. And I would prefer to work in the NYC area. CT maybe.
